Engine and Performance: Power and Capability
When we talk about the 2021 Ford Bronco Sport, we have to discuss its heart: the engine. Ford offered two engine options for the 2021 model year. The standard engine is a 1.5-liter EcoBoost three-cylinder engine that delivers a respectable amount of power, perfect for everyday driving. This engine is fuel-efficient, making it a great choice for those who prioritize gas mileage. For those craving more power and performance, there's the available 2.0-liter EcoBoost four-cylinder engine. This engine packs a serious punch, providing ample power for off-road adventures and highway driving. Both engines are paired with an eight-speed automatic transmission, ensuring smooth gear changes and optimal performance. The Bronco Sport's performance isn't just about the engine; it's also about its off-road capabilities.
The 2021 Bronco Sport comes standard with all-wheel drive, providing excellent traction and stability on various terrains. The Terrain Management System allows you to select different drive modes, each optimizing the vehicle's performance for specific conditions. These modes include Normal, Eco, Sport, Slippery, Sand, and Mud/Ruts. The top-of-the-line Badlands trim takes it a step further with an advanced 4x4 system, a rear differential lock, and Trail Control, enhancing its off-road prowess. The Bronco Sport has what it takes to handle challenging terrain, whether you're navigating a rocky trail or a snowy road. The engine options and the off-road capabilities work together to create a vehicle that is both fun to drive and capable of handling whatever you throw at it. From the city streets to the trails less traveled, the 2021 Ford Bronco Sport is ready for anything.
Interior and Technology: Comfort and Innovation
Alright, let's step inside the 2021 Ford Bronco Sport and take a look at its interior and technology. The cabin is designed with practicality and comfort in mind. The materials are durable, and the layout is user-friendly. The interior is spacious enough for passengers and cargo, making it a great choice for families and adventurers alike. The infotainment system is a highlight, featuring an 8-inch touchscreen display with Ford's SYNC 3 system. This system is intuitive and offers a variety of features, including Apple CarPlay and Android Auto compatibility, allowing you to seamlessly integrate your smartphone.
Beyond the infotainment system, the 2021 Bronco Sport is packed with technology. Features like a digital instrument cluster, a premium audio system, and a suite of driver-assistance features enhance the driving experience. The driver-assistance features include things like blind-spot monitoring, lane-keeping assist, and adaptive cruise control, providing added safety and convenience. The interior design of the Bronco Sport is not only functional but also stylish, with unique design elements that pay homage to the original Bronco. From the color schemes to the materials used, every detail has been carefully considered to create a comfortable and enjoyable driving experience. The 2021 Bronco Sport's interior is a testament to Ford's commitment to combining practicality, comfort, and innovation. The Bronco Sport offers a blend of ruggedness and sophistication, making it a great choice for anyone looking for a versatile and tech-savvy SUV.

Troubleshooting Tips: What to Do When Something Goes Wrong
So, your 2021 Ford Bronco Sport isn't running quite right? Don't panic! Here are some troubleshooting tips to help you diagnose and address common issues. If you notice a warning light on your dashboard, the first thing you should do is consult your owner's manual. The manual will provide information about the meaning of each warning light and what steps you should take. Many issues can be resolved with a simple fix. If the check engine light is on, it could be something as simple as a loose gas cap. Make sure the cap is tightened securely, and see if the light goes off after a few driving cycles.
If the issue persists, you may need to use an OBD-II scanner to diagnose the problem. An OBD-II scanner can read diagnostic trouble codes (DTCs) that provide information about what is causing the issue. You can purchase an OBD-II scanner at most auto parts stores. Once you have the DTCs, you can use the internet to research potential solutions. If you're not comfortable working on your vehicle, it's always best to take it to a qualified mechanic. A mechanic can diagnose the issue and make the necessary repairs. When you take your vehicle to a mechanic, provide them with as much information as possible, including the DTCs, any symptoms you've noticed, and any recent work that has been done on the vehicle. This information will help the mechanic diagnose the issue quickly and efficiently.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) about the 2021 Ford Bronco Sport
Let's get into some commonly asked questions about the 2021 Ford Bronco Sport. This will help you to understand the car better, especially if you are thinking about purchasing one.
Q: What are the different trim levels available for the 2021 Ford Bronco Sport? A: The 2021 Ford Bronco Sport is available in several trim levels, including Base, Big Bend, Outer Banks, and Badlands. Each trim offers a unique set of features and capabilities.
Q: Does the 2021 Ford Bronco Sport have good fuel economy? A: Yes, the 2021 Ford Bronco Sport offers good fuel economy, especially with the 1.5-liter EcoBoost engine. The EPA-estimated fuel economy is around 25-28 MPG combined, depending on the trim and engine option.
Q: Is the 2021 Ford Bronco Sport good for off-roading? A: Absolutely! The Bronco Sport is designed to handle off-road adventures. The Badlands trim is specifically designed for off-roading, with features like an advanced 4x4 system and a rear differential lock.
Q: What kind of technology is available in the 2021 Ford Bronco Sport? A: The 2021 Ford Bronco Sport features an 8-inch touchscreen display with Ford's SYNC 3 system, Apple CarPlay and Android Auto compatibility, a digital instrument cluster, and a suite of driver-assistance features.
Q: How reliable is the 2021 Ford Bronco Sport? A: The reliability of the 2021 Ford Bronco Sport is generally considered to be average. Regular maintenance and addressing any issues promptly can help ensure its longevity.
